Retiree Group Endorses Jahana Hayes for Re-election to U.S. House

Cites Commitment to Expanding and Protecting Earned Social Security and Medicare Benefits, Lowering Drug Prices

Waterbury, CT – Members of the Alliance for Retired Americans proudly announced their endorsement of Jahana Hayes for re-election to the U.S. House of Representatives from Connecticut’s 5th Congressional District today. The Connecticut Alliance is a grassroots advocacy organization with more than 59,000 members across the state.

“Rep. Hayes has proven that she will look out for older people in Washington. She has earned a perfect lifetime score of 100% in the Alliance’s annual Congressional Voting Record,” said Bette Marafino, president of the Connecticut Alliance for Retired Americans. “She knows that thousands of seniors in her district rely on the Social Security and Medicare benefits they have earned, and she’s working to protect all of our retirement security.”

“I am so grateful for the endorsement of the Alliance for Retired Americans,” said Rep. Hayes. “Our seniors have done the hard work of helping to build this country, that’s why I will work just as hard to protect Social Security, fight for affordable healthcare and make sure our retirees are never left behind.”

In addition, Marafino noted that Rep. Hayes has been a leader in the fight to protect earned pension benefits and lower drug prices. She voted to require Medicare to negotiate lower drug prices for seniors, cap out-of-pocket drug costs at $2,000 a year and cap insulin copays at $35 a month. She also voted to provide hearing benefits under Medicare and $150 billion for Medicaid home care services.
